By the way, would you invest in the 35mm 1.4 today, knowing that fujifilm could soon release a mk2 version (hello dear speculations!!)?

I would, yes, for the same reasons I wrote above. But obviously we all have our own feelings and approaches to these things. That said, if you're shooting rapid, unpredictable movement, you might want to consider getting the 35mm f2 rather than then 1.4. The autofocusing performance of the former might be a little better, even if it lacks the 1.4's faster aperture and legendary pixie dust. Be sure to leave "High performance" mode enabled on your X-T30 as well.
